If faces are fortunes, those of the performers seen from the Melbourne Town Hall balcony are hidden assets. But actions speak louder than words, and thus we recognise, from left to right, Fritz Kramer, pianist; Hans Rexeis, first tenor; Erich Collin, second tenor; Harry Frommermann, buffo and musical arranger; Roman Cycowski, baritone; and Rudolf Mayreder, bass.
